想要实现的功能:直接按 F12 调出 Chrome 开发者工具
有道友遇到吗?有没有解决方法?
1
seanzxx 2023-06-09 22:44:10 +08:00 via iPhone
第三方键盘默认就是 F 键就是字面的功能,和苹果的键盘设置是不一样的,但如果安装了 Karabiner ,他缺省会把第三方键盘的 F 键设置成和苹果内置键盘一样
|
2
MiracleXYZ 2023-06-10 00:10:02 +08:00 1
我的 Keychron K3 Pro 也是同样的问题,但是支持改键,我用 VIA 一个一个替换过去的
|
3
pricky777 2023-06-10 00:24:00 +08:00
我感觉如果要用标准 F 键,好像只能放弃功能键了。。。
|
4
houhaibushihai OP @pricky777 功能键我几乎用不到,前端最近调试比较多,就希望标准 F 功能
|
5
houhaibushihai OP @MiracleXYZ VIA 是什么?平常的键盘有修改方案吗?
|
6
houhaibushihai OP @seanzxx 你的意思是使用第三方键盘默认的 F 键功能(第三方键盘不切换到 Mac 模式),那么 command 这些就需要另外映射了
|
7
pffrank 2023-06-10 18:14:36 +08:00
啥键盘? FN+F12 不行吗?
|
8
WonderUniverse 2023-06-10 18:25:57 +08:00
罗技的只要按一下 fn+esc 就可以切换功能键和 F 了
|
9
houhaibushihai OP @pffrank 国产的一个键盘 vgn v98pro ,fn+f12 没问题,我是想直接设置为 f12
目前有搜到 macOS 系统设置里有,但是设置完只对苹果自家设备(键盘)好使 第三方键盘无效,可能第三方驱动有问题还是什么原因 就是问问,不能解决考虑退货了 |
10
pffrank 2023-06-10 19:56:14 +08:00
@houhaibushihai 厂家默认给 F11 、12 设置快捷键了,我的 iqunix 是音量,只能按 FN+F 键。
试试 keychron ,他家有驱动软件可以自定义 |
11
MiracleXYZ 2023-06-10 22:42:42 +08:00 via iPhone
@houhaibushihai 用来改键的,比如修改键盘映射或者一些宏,需要键盘硬件支持才行
|
12
langforwork 2023-06-21 00:56:45 +08:00
我刚买了一把杜卡洛。我这键盘 Fn +F1-12 确实是正常的功能键,直接 F1-12 是媒体键,Karabiner 似乎无效,如果在键位设置软件中设置 Fn 的触发为 F1-12 可以,但是媒体键就失效了,我也在找其他办法看看能不能改,真希望官方能把这设计改过来。看了一篇文章若有所悟,https://36kr.com/p/2251502860152705
|
13
Wxh16144 2023-07-19 20:41:04 +08:00
+1, 我现在也遇到了, 联系客服, 告知我要 via 改
|
14
Wxh16144 2023-07-19 21:21:26 +08:00
@MiracleXYZ 我大概看了一下教程, 我和你同款 Keychron K3 Pro, 用 via 备份一份当前配置, 然后用编辑器将 layer 0 和 layer 1 的功能键交换一个位置, 保存一份新的配置文件, 然后用 via 导入即可. 我还用 git 保留了记录. 方便后面的人参考 https://github.com/Wxh16144/dotfiles/commit/a890ad9c71516cc392ae360081941f701019fa32
也可以直接下载: https://raw.githubusercontent.com/Wxh16144/dotfiles/a890ad9c71516cc392ae360081941f701019fa32/backup/keyboard/keychron_k3_pro_ansi_white.layout.json |
15
orangutan92 327 天前
@WonderUniverse #8 除了罗技还有哪些键盘支持呢,我用的 VGN S99 ,非要 FN+F1
|
16
wswdavid 163 天前
@orangutan92 niz 可以,直接 F 区
|
17
orangutan92 162 天前
Function Key Pro 可以覆盖 f1 ,但 f3 不行
|
18
Zien 18 天前
我用的小米的 TKL 也遇到了。。。。。
而且 Fn+ESC 切换只有在 Windows 模式下有效,macOS 模式则无法生效, 怀疑把逻辑写死到固件里了,而且我严重怀疑这个 macOS 模式下的快捷键,不是映射按键,而是直接做了一个类似于快捷方式的东西来编程实现的,或者根本没有按照两个系统的规范进行映射。 如果这样的话,双系统键盘的意义是什么呢? 我直接用 Windows 模式,然后在 macOS 里改修饰按键不是更简单? 莫名其妙。 |